Our Services

NMi offers testing, training, and certification services for EV charging solutions. These include:

1. Training / Education Services:
– Regulatory Landscape
– German market positioning

2. Testing Services following:
– German legal documents REA 6A / PTB-A 50.7
– German document VDE-AR-E 2418-3-100
– Separate or integrated AC electricity meters: EN 50470-1/3 or EN 62052-11/A11 with EN 50470-3
– Separate or integrated DC electricity meters: EN 50470-4 and IEC 62053-41 (together with IEC EN 62052-11/A11)

In Germany, charging stations used for billing purposes require national approval based on a conformity assessment towards the German Eichrecht, the German Calibration Law. As a designated Notified Body by the German ministry BMWK, NMi can support you in all aspects of this AC or DC equipment assessment.

Active participation in IEC and CENELEC TC 13, as well as WELMEC and OIML, together with our position as Notified Body for MessEG & MessEV positions NMi to help you swiftly gain access to European and global EV markets.
